Trump’s Niece Fears for Ukraine Post-Election
Donald Trump’s lesbian niece Mary Trump often speaks out against her uncle and president-elect, especially in regards to his position on Ukraine. Mary Trump has been a staunch supporter of Ukraine and has lauded their efforts and retaliation against Vladimir Putin’s invasion of the country.
The war in Ukraine has passed 1000 days now, and as her uncle is now the future president, Mary fears for the future of the country. Trump has alleged pulling the United States’ support out of the conflict, after Ukraine has made itself a formidable force with the U.S. and European Union backing it. Without that support, Mary fears that they may be in trouble.
“The fate of Ukraine and Zelenskyy may rest with Donald Trump, Putin’s puppet, a man who is enamored of and beholden to the very autocrat who wants to destroy our ally.” She calls Ukraine’s supporters into action, saying that we must continue to support Ukraine however we can, even if a Trump presidency may take away governmental support. “We can start by saying to my uncle, ‘Go f**k yourself,'” she says.
She has been vocal about not supporting her uncle for the duration of his campaign, and has lauded Kamala Harris’ efforts. After he won, she was shocked, stating that she thought we knew better. She also claims that it will be worse than 2016 when he first was inaugurated.
“There aren’t words to convey effectively how devastating it is that the American experiment has failed … to find that tens of millions of us are completely sanguine about the repercussions the rest of the world and future generations now face because of this violent, reckless decision.” As with Kamala Harris, and many others opposing Trump, she highlights that we must continue the fight as we are faced with the fascism and oppression that has been lurking for a long time.
